The US State Division has known as for the discharge of Cambodian commerce union chief Chhim Sithar.

Chhim Sithar, above proper, with different union leaders, was detained by Cambodia’s autocratic authorities final week after organizing employee protests at NagaWorld, the nation’s largest on line casino resort. (Picture: VOD Cambodia)
Sithar was arrested at Phnom Penh Worldwide Airport on November 26 after getting back from a labor convention in Australia. She is the president of the Labor Rights Supported Union of Khmer Staff of NagaWorld (LRSU) which has been embroiled in a year-long dispute over staff’ rights with Cambodia’s largest on line casino, NagaWorld.
She faces as much as two years in jail if convicted on fees of incitement to commit felony by disturbing the social order.
“We urge Cambodian authorities to launch Chhim Sithar and all detained commerce unionists exercising their rights to freedom of affiliation and peaceable meeting, drop fees in opposition to them, and transfer to constructively resolve their disputes,” the division stated in an announcement.

NagaWorld, in Phnom Penh, is owned by billionaire Chen Lip Keong and is the one built-in resort within the nation. It has a monopoly inside a 120-mile radius of the Cambodian capital.
Cambodians are forbidden by legislation to gamble, and so NagaWorld largely exists to lure rich Chinese language vacationers to blow their hard-earned yuan at its gaming tables.

Employees started placing in January 2022 in solidarity with 365 of their colleagues who had been laid off the earlier April. NagaWorld stated the job cuts had been designed to cut back prices to alleviate the monetary pressures of the coronavirus pandemic.

However LRSU argued the layoffs had been unlawful and the severance packages, refused by many, insufficient. Subsequent picketing outdoors the on line casino led to mass arrests, which had been condemned by the United Nations.
Cambodia is an authoritarian one-party state. It has claimed NagaWorld demonstrators had been arrested as a result of they had been a menace to nationwide safety and since they had been breaching COVID-19 protocols. The union stated this was a pretext to suppress dissent.

The Cambodian authorities has intensified a crackdown on civilian protests since 2017. Based on a report by Human Rights Watch, it has used the worldwide pandemic to “step up … repression of critics and activists and undertake extra draconian legal guidelines.”
The US authorities urged Cambodia to uphold labor rights obligations and mediate a decision between NagaWorld and the union.
It additionally demanded the discharge of Cambodian American lawyer Theary Sing. She was one in all 60 opposition figures detained in June on fees of conspiring to commit treason. She was sentenced to 6 years in jail after a mass trial that was condemned by the West as politically motivated. Her crime was to criticize the federal government on Fb.
